We are often told of the importance of a "headline" when creating a direct mail piece. The headline is what draws the reader in and encourages them to keep reading, so yes, it is extremely important to any marketing letter. However, there are many other important parts of a good marketing letter. One that you don't hear discussed as often, but it's critical, is the "offer."
A good offer can make all of the difference in the world in the overall results of your direct mail piece, or in any ad for that matter. There are specific items that should be included in an offer to increase its effectiveness. Try and include all of the following items in your offer for any of your marketing letters.For instance, NEW is a power word and is an attention grabber when used in your offer. It could be a new product or a new service. Or, possibly just repackage something to make it new in comparison to how it's been presented in the past.The price of an item or service is almost always important to the buyer. Everyone likes to think they are getting a good deal. If you can present the price as a special discount, or a sale price for a limited time it adds power to the offer.You may be able to offer a bonus or a premium for those individuals that purchase your product or service. It creates value and could be the motivator that tips the offer in your favor.Another highly effective tool for increasing the results of your offer is to include a gift for responding. Although similar to a bonus it can be something totally unrelated to your product or service. For instance, a clock, or a brief-case could be appealing. There are numerous sources of gifts that appear to have much greater value than what you actually pay for them.Always include a time limit on the offer to create a sense of urgency and to stimulate a prompt response. If your offer lacks this critical component you will be reducing the response to what could otherwise be an excellent marketing piece.Although you occasionally see an offer with some of the above mentioned items, you don't as often see an offer with all of them. However, why not make a check list and use all of them. You go to a lot of time and expense to send your customers and prospects an offer, why not make it as effective as possible. The best offer will include all five of these techniques.
